Output 52b9b26b0671bc56b55d0082725e4633faa714911cc8dd00d1d12bcf386f4c05:0

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ec030578cc044dee12d7d426a42d120fefeadbad OP_EQUAL
address
3PCw1k8ngYKLALCtWpEjrPBhHhFGGjXthC
transaction
52b9b26b0671bc56b55d0082725e4633faa714911cc8dd00d1d12bcf386f4c05
confirmations
292516
spent
true